The factors that affect your salary from the options provided are:
- where you live: Cost of living and regional demand for certain jobs can influence salary levels.
- the company you work for: Different companies have varying pay scales based on industry, size, and profitability.
The other options generally do not directly impact salary:
- the amount of debt you incur: This can influence your financial situation but does not directly affect salary.
- the intellectual rewards you experience: This pertains to job satisfaction and fulfillment, not salary.
- your tax rate: While this affects take-home pay, it does not directly change the salary offered by an employer.
Thus, the correct selections are "where you live" and "the company you work for."
